LAX to Hollywood Chauffeur Service

Seventeen miles is the shortest transfer we publish and among the least predictable, because the whole trip hinges on one road. The 405 north to the 10 east is the fast way when the 405 is behaving; when it is not, La Cienega and the surface grid beat it outright, and the difference between those two choices is twenty minutes on a bad afternoon. Making that call correctly requires having driven both that week. It is the sort of thing a local chauffeur knows and a routing estimate does not.

Three kinds of passenger take this route and all three care about timing more than mileage. Entertainment-industry travellers with a call time, who need the car confirmed the night before rather than hailed at 4am. Event and awards-season traffic for the Dolby, the Chinese Theatre, the Palladium and the Hollywood Bowl, where street closures around Highland and Hollywood are the operational problem and staging outside the ring is the answer. And guests checking into the Roosevelt or a hotel on the Boulevard or Sunset, near Sunset and Vine, who would rather not negotiate a fare after a flight. Six seats, six bags, a fare fixed at booking. Seventeen miles, and normally 30 to 55 minutes. That is the shortest run we publish and also one of the least predictable, because the 405 north decides it. When the 405 is moving we take it to the 10 east; when it is not, La Cienega and the surface streets are genuinely faster. That call gets made on the day by someone driving it, which is not the same as a dispatcher adding a fixed buffer.
